Going to be kinda sad to see the film go....not sure how many people know this, but the film was made by Greg MacGillivary and MacGillivary Freeman Films. These are the same IMAX Filmmakers that made Everest, The Living Sea, Dolphins, etc. So even though it is old, it holds a special place (I'm an IMAX Theater Director)

Personally , I never looked at the Canadian film as stereotypical , but merely a cultural experience. I know that Canadians aren't all lumberjacks and fishermen but , it's part of the country , just like cowboys and pioneers are part of American culture. I'm always surprised at how many people don't truly get the whole purpose of World Showcase. It isn't to show how modern and progressive Germany , Canada , Japan or the United States have become. It's to celebrate the great cultures of all the countries and how those cultures enabled us to get to where we are now.
I , for one , would be totally disappointed if I came to the Canada pavilion and they had displays of computer technology and the buildings were all modern skyscrapers, and the film was all about Canada in 2007. That's not to say that I'm not interested in Canada as it is now, I just enjoy the history.
Everyone should be proud of their heritage. As an American should I be ashamed of the colonial costumes that the CM's at The American Adventure wear , simply because no one wears those outfits anymore ? All the countries in WS are represented by CM's who wear clothing that people can associate with their historic cultures. Maybe the lumberjack outfit isn't the best repesentation of Canada's history , but it isn't a negative one either.
I think it's great that there is a new film for Canada , but I surely hope that all the great culture is not excised out of the production , and that we can still see the heritage and beauty of the country that complements the modern aspect.
